13 Lothrop Street

    13, LOTHROP STREET, LONDON, W10 4JB

    This terraced freehold property on Lothrop Street last sold in July 2019 for £720,000. Based on price growth in the W10 district since then, its estimated current value is £840,687 — placing it in the 94th percentile nationally and the 66th percentile within W10. The property covers 63 m² (678 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£13,344 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— W10

    W10 covers Notting Hill, Ladbroke Grove and North Kensington in west London, nestled between Paddington and Hammersmith. It is among the capital's most affluent and culturally distinctive neighbourhoods, known for its Victorian terraces, vibrant street markets and creative community.
